The Execution Factor Summary

The Execution Factor Summary Brief Summary

Kim Perell’s ‘The Execution Factor’ teaches the keys to effective execution: vision, passion, action, resilience, and relationships. Turning ideas into reality, the book reveals how aligning these traits helps achieve personal and professional success.

Main Lessons

  1. Having a clear, specific, and meaningful vision guides personal and professional success.
  2. Authenticity in vision is crucial, ensuring it aligns with personal values and preferences.
  3. Testing a vision on a small scale helps avoid investing in unsuitable paths.
  4. Passion involves making sacrifices and enduring hardships to pursue what you love.
  5. Regularly engaging with your passion and making necessary trade-offs is essential.
  6. Taking consistent action, rather than overthinking, drives progress.
  7. Commitment to continuous forward movement catalyzes long-term success.
  8. Resilience involves not only withstanding setbacks but using them as growth opportunities.
  9. Daily self-care practices strengthen resilience, reducing stress and anxiety.
  10. Building a network of supportive, positive relationships amplifies personal achievements.
  11. Conducting an annual life audit helps identify and nurture mutually beneficial relationships.
  12. Limiting negative influences maximizes positivity and supports passion pursuits.
  13. Effective execution necessitates bold actions and the courage to reassess when needed.
